Step 1

Use a non-acetone remover to get rid of any lingering dirt or nastiness (i.e. the grunge chipped manicure you are sporting). Use the nail file to shape your nails to the desired length. The buffing block is better used to smooth the surface of the nail (pro-tip: this will remove the yellow stains that occur from wearing too much dark polish).
